Prescription Drug Drop-Off Program

Esta Goldstein Located at Pinal County Sheriff’s Substation. Schedule: Jan. 8, Friday, from 10 a.m. to noon Jan. 26, Tuesday, from 2 to 4 p.m. Requirements: Everyone entering the facility must wear a mask, social distancing must be observed, and medications must be in sealed plastic bags.
